Broccoli Stir Fry
 
Prep time
Cook time
Total time
 
Serves: 3
Ingredients
Base ingredient:
  • Broccoli - 1 big flower
To blanch:
  • Water - ¾ th of a pan
  • Turmeric powder - ¼ tsp
  • Salt - 1 tsp
To temper:
  • Oil - 1 tsp
  • Cumin seeds - ½ tsp
  • Curry leaves - 4
  • Garlic cloves - 4
Spices:
  • Plain Chilli powder - 1 tsp or more
  • Salt - ½ tsp or as required
Instructions
How to blanch Broccoli?
  1. Fill ¾th of a steel pan with water and let it boil in high flame.
  2. Once it starts to rolling boil, add ¼ tsp turmeric powder and 1 tsp salt and boil for 1 more minute.
  3. Add washed and chopped broccoli florets and turn off the stove.
  4. In just 10 seconds, take out the blanched broccoli florets using perforated ladle and transfer them to a colander and let the water drain completely.
How to cook Broccoli?
  1. Add groundnut/coconut oil to a pan, preferably iron pan.
  2. Once oil is hot, simmer and add ½ tsp cumin seeds/jeera. Do not burn it.
  3. Once cumin seeds start to hiss, add curry leaves and finely chopped garlic cloves.
  4. Fry for 1 minute. Do not let garlic change to dark color.
  5. In sim, add 1 tsp plain chilli powder and give a quick mix. Do not char it.
  6. Immediately, as soon as possible, add blanched & drained broccoli. Make sure no water is added. If you are not using a colander to drain blanched broccoli, there might be water in the bottom of the vessel. So, take the florets using hand/perforated ladle and add without the water.
  7. Add ½ tsp salt, give a quick mix in high flame.
  8. Cook closed in medium flame for 3 to 4 mins. Scroll down to see what other veggies can be added along with broccoli and when to add them?
  9. Open and a generous pinch of Oregano(optional) if you like the flavor. Stir fry in high flame for 1 or 2 mins. Overall cooking time should not exceed 5 mins. Broccoli should not be cooked mushy as it loses nutrition. Reduce cooking time, if you prefer more crunchy bites.
  10. Switch off and transfer the contents to a bowl, immediately.
Notes
1. Capsicum, Peas and Potato are our favorite additions to broccoli stir fry. Scroll down to see how and when to add them ?
2. Cumin seeds can be replaced with Cumin powder. If using cumin powder, just use ¼ tsp and add it along with chilli powder.
3. Increase/decrease chilli powder as per your spice level.
4. Curry leaves are optional and can be skipped.
5. Garlic gives nice flavor but can be skipped, if you don't like the flavor of garlic.
6. Broccoli is blanched to get rid of any pesticides(inorganic) / any pests(organic).
